What color analysis reads

Personal color analysis works out which colors sit well against your own coloring, and which ones quietly fight it. It reads your undertone, whether your skin leans warm or cool, before anything else.

Then your value, how light or dark you are overall, and your chroma, how much saturation you can carry before a color starts wearing you. Those three axes are what separate the twelve seasons, and they are what our guide to seasonal color analysis walks through in full.

It is also why a color that looks superb on someone else can leave you looking tired in the same photograph. That part is not a matter of taste, and it is measurable, which is the half we built on data.

How the 12 season system works

The twelve season system is the standard professional stylists have used for decades. Four base seasons, each split three ways by which quality dominates, giving you a palette tuned to your coloring rather than to a rough guess at warm or cool.
